Definitions
surgical removal of something without cutting into it
Word origin
From Latin ēnucleātus, perfect passive participle of ēnucleō (“to remove the kernel, stone, etc. from (a fruit, grape)”). Equivalent to enucleate + -ion.
Used in a sentence
“Perhaps this enucleation of Aristotle's theory is enough, without further commentary.”
